Best Regards, RM --- In analogue-sequencer@yahoogroups.com, "colinfraser_com" <colin@c...> wrote: > Folks, > > I've uploaded a photo and FPD file of a new desktop panel for P3. > This layout has the boards as close together as possible, with the > keypad, display, DATA and TEMPO pots moved up a little to minimise > the panel height too. It also finally has the PLED aperture exactly > centred over the display characters. > I'm going to bend some aluminium sheet for a rear enclosure, and > hold it all together with some wooden end-cheeks. > The FPD file may be a useful source of measurements for anyone > wanting to machine their own panel, or to get one from Schaeffer. > The panel will cost 74 euro plus shipping. > Note that I use 7mm holes for mounting the data and tempo pots, but > 7.5mm holes for the step pots, and they need a little extra room to > fit when they're all mounted in the boards. > > Cheers, > Colin f
